    Sweetwater Campground is a beautiful destination located on the banks of Allatoona Lake in Cartersville, Georgia. With over 150 spacious reservable campsites, this campground provides an ideal setting for families and outdoor enthusiasts alike. Here, you can immerse yourself in the stunning views of the lake, partake in a variety of recreational activities, and appreciate the natural beauty surrounding you.

    Key Features

    • Spacious Campsites: Over 150 reservable sites, including electric and non-electric options, accommodate both tent campers and RVs.
    • Lakefront Access: Some sites provide direct access to Allatoona Lake, offering picturesque views and the soothing sounds of water.
    • Amenities: Each campsite comes equipped with fire rings, picnic tables, drinking water, flush toilets, and hot showers for a comfortable stay.
    • Recreational Opportunities: The campground is surrounded by various recreational options such as fishing, swimming, boating, and hiking.
    • Wildlife Viewing: Campers can enjoy observing local wildlife in their natural habitat, thanks to the campground’s serene environment.

    Accessibility and Camp Rules

    Sweetwater Campground adheres to certain regulations to ensure a pleasant experience for all visitors. Campers are reminded that:

    • A maximum of eight people are allowed per campsite.
    • Up to three pets may accompany each site.
    • To maintain a peaceful environment, off-road vehicles, golf carts, and ATVs are not permitted.
    • The entrance gate is locked from 10:30 p.m. to 7:00 a.m., ensuring safety and security.

    Natural Features and Nearby Attractions

    Allatoona Lake, renowned for its beautiful shoreline stretching over 270 miles, offers endless opportunities for outdoor activities. The area is perfect for sunbathing, swimming, and fishing, with species such as bass, crappie, and catfish abundant in the lake.

    Nearby attractions include:

    • Tellus Science Museum: An interactive museum that engages visitors of all ages.
    • Etowah Indian Mounds: A historical site showcasing the rich Native American history of the region.
    • Red Top Mountain State Park: This park has over 15 miles of hiking trails, ideal for both novice and experienced hikers.
    • Kennesaw Mountain National Battlefield: A significant Civil War site with educational programs and trails.

    Planning Your Visit

    When planning your camping trip at Sweetwater Campground, keep in mind that the camping limit is 14 consecutive days or 14 non-consecutive days within any 30-day period at Corps of Engineers operated campgrounds. Reservations can be made online, and visitors are encouraged to review the rules and reservation policies before arriving.
